Chief Joseph Dam
Power station
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
The Chief Joseph Dam is a concrete gravity dam on the Columbia River, 2.4 km upriver from Bridgeport, Washington. The dam is 877 km upriver from the mouth of the Columbia at Astoria, Oregon. Chief Joseph Dam is situated 1¼ miles southwest of Dunes Trailhead.

Bridgeport
Photo: Andrew Filer,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Bridgeport is a town of 2,600 people in the Columbia River Plateau of Washington State. It has over 1.5 mi of Columbia River waterfront within the City Limits.
